    Tagaro works in Puglia, the warm heel of southern Italy and the home of Primitivo, a thick-skinned grape that ripens early and to high sugar in the region's hot, dry climate. The vineyards sit on red, iron-rich soils over limestone, free-draining ground that keeps yields moderate and concentrates the fruit, while the relentless Mediterranean sun pushes Primitivo to fifteen percent alcohol with deep colour and ripe, dark fruit. After fermentation the wine ages eight months in oak barrels, where slow oxygen exchange through the wood softens the tannins and the malolactic conversion rounds the acidity, while the barrel adds the vanilla, cinnamon and spice that frame the fruit. The colour is intense and deep. The nose is generous, with vanilla, cinnamon, raisin and burnt orange over ripe plum and cherry. The palate is full bodied and warming, with ripe, soft tannins, a faint sweetness to the fruit and a long, spiced finish. This is a rich, approachable red rather than a structured one for keeping. Serve at 16 to 18 degrees with hearty, flavourful food.
